Common questions

Is it okay to send belated Christmas wishes?

Absolutely! It's always better to send a thoughtful message late than not at all. A belated wish shows you were still thinking of them, even if time got away from you.

What's the best way to apologize for a late Christmas wish?

A simple, sincere apology is usually best. You can briefly acknowledge the delay ('Sorry this is a bit late!') or add a lighthearted touch ('My apologies, Santa's reindeer hit some traffic!'). The most important thing is the warm wish itself.

Should I still send a physical card if it's very late?

Yes, a physical card is still a lovely gesture, even if it arrives in January. If you prefer, an email or text message can be a quicker way to convey your belated greetings, especially if it's very much after the holiday.
